A Design Revolution: The Birth of the Archlight
The Archlight’s success isn't accidental. Ghesquière, known for his avant-garde approach to design, meticulously crafted a trainer that challenged conventional aesthetics. The exaggerated tongue, extending significantly beyond the shoe's upper, is a dramatic focal point, adding a futuristic and almost sculptural quality. This isn’t just about adding visual interest; it contributes to the shoe’s overall comfort, providing extra padding and support for the wearer's foot.
The wave-shaped outsole is equally groundbreaking. This isn’t simply a stylistic choice; it's a carefully considered element that contributes to the Archlight's unique silhouette and provides a surprising level of comfort and cushioning. The undulating form subtly elevates the heel, offering a slight lift and a more streamlined profile. This design choice is a masterclass in marrying form and function, showcasing Ghesquière’s ability to push boundaries while maintaining practicality.
The LV Circle signature, subtly yet effectively incorporated into both the tongue and outsole, further elevates the Archlight’s status. It’s a discreet nod to the brand's heritage, a subtle reminder of the luxury and craftsmanship behind the design. The careful placement of the logo prevents it from being overwhelming, instead allowing the unique shape and silhouette of the shoe to take centre stage.
Beyond the Silhouette: Material and Colourways
The Louis Vuitton Archlight trainers aren’t just about a single design. The brand has consistently offered a range of materials and colours, ensuring there’s an Archlight to suit every taste and occasion. From classic monochrome designs in black, white, and beige, to vibrant and bold colour combinations, the Archlight boasts a versatility that allows it to seamlessly transition from casual daytime wear to more sophisticated evening ensembles.
The use of premium materials is a hallmark of the Louis Vuitton brand, and the Archlight is no exception. High-quality leather, supple calfskin, and innovative technical fabrics are often employed, ensuring both durability and a luxurious feel. Some limited-edition releases even feature unique materials, further demonstrating the brand's commitment to pushing creative boundaries. These special editions often become highly sought-after collector's items, driving up their value in the pre-owned market.
